Classic luxury and professional service near the beach
The Hilton Waikiki pairs the amenities and professionalism of a business hotel with the pampering luxuries of a resort. Recently renovated with hip dining space and glamorous common areas, Hilton Waikiki is one of the best-kept secrets in Honolulu. Sleek rooms with balconies offer high-tech amenities and Crabtree & Evelyn toiletries. The pop-age diner, MAC 24-7, delivers diner favorites to rooms around-the-clock. Waikiki's most serene beach and swimming area are located two blocks away.

Location
The Hilton Waikiki is located on a quiet end of Kalakaua Avenue, two blocks from Waikiki Beach and the main shopping and dining district. Unobtrusively elegant, the location provides serenity and exclusivity. Stroll 10 minutes to reach the Honolulu Zoo and Kapiolani Park.
Rooms
The hotel's 601 rooms have been recently renovated. Chic and sleek, each room includes a balcony, 42-inch plasma HDTV, Hilton Serenity Bed and Crabtree & Evelyn toiletries. The unique GuestLink service, which enables you to pair in-room TV screen with your laptop, video camera and MP3 player is available in all rooms. The always-open hotel diner delivers food to your room any time of day or night.
Dining
Voted best late night eats in Honolulu and featured on The Travel Channel's Man vs. Food, MAC 24-7 Bar & Restaurant melds hip décor with hearty portions of island-influenced and upscale diner dishes. Don't miss the pancakes, saimin and cupcakes. Guests can order food to their room any time of day or night, around-the-clock. The hotel's chic lobby bar features appetizers and exotic cocktails.

THE ONLY WAY TO ATTEND A WEDDING IN WAIKIKI
Beautiful hotel, close to Waikiki Beach, the Honolulu Zoo, the Honolulu Aquarium, Kapiolani Park (jog, walk, see soccer games). The front desk clerk gave us a GREAT room-29th floor/ocean view! we could see the surfers waiting for the sets, many colorful saiboats, and cruise ships. we had a family wedding to attend, in the same hotel, and instead of getting up early, getting ready, and driving into town we decided to stay at the hotel the night before the wedding. And we had absolutely NO WORRIES on the wedding night when we had drinks...just "drove" the elevator up to our beautiful room! EVERYONE-valet, front desk, banquet employees, and housekeeping were very FRIENDLY and accommodating. I am certain that the tourist visiting our lovely islands would not regret staying here.

Old School
Good bang for your buck
First off, you will not spend too much time in your room. If you do than Honolulu is a waste! The room is great- very clean and very modern. The bed is unreal- excellent sleeps after a day of walking the beach or surfing. The fitness room is decent but small. The pool is good enough but again, use the beach you are in Hawaii not Arizona! Location is good- about a three minute walk to the beach and to various shops and restaurants. My one complaint is the lack of wireless Internet- Hilton needs to get with the 21 century! But overall my wife and I were very satisfied with the hotel. Here is a tip- breakfast at Eggs N Things. It is right off the beach, 3 minutes from the hotel. It was voted one of the best places to eat breakfast in America- amazing food!
